Symptoms

  • •Check engine light illuminated
  • •Rough idle
  • •Decreased acceleration and power
  • •Unusual engine noises
  • •Decreased fuel economy (noted by the driver)
  • •Strong fuel odor near the vehicle

Solution
1. Preparation
  • Gather tools and parts required.
  • Ensure the vehicle is parked on a flat surface and the engine is cool.
  • Disconnect the battery before performing electrical diagnostics.
2. Replace Fuel Filter
  • Locate the fuel filter (typically along the fuel line).
  • Use a wrench to disconnect the fuel lines from the filter.
  • Remove the old fuel filter and install the new one (ensure the flow direction is correct).
  • Reconnect the fuel lines and check for any leaks.
3. Clean or Replace Air Filter
  • Open the air filter housing and remove the air filter.
  • Inspect the filter for dirt or blockages.
  • Clean the filter if reusable or replace it with a new one.
  • Reassemble the air filter housing securely.
4. Inspect and Clean Fuel Injectors
  • Use a fuel injector cleaning kit or take the vehicle to a professional for ultrasonic cleaning.
  • If cleaning is not effective, replace the faulty injectors.
  • Reinstall any components removed during the injector inspection.
5. Check Tire Pressure
  • Use a tire pressure gauge to check the inflation of all tires.
  • Inflate tires to the manufacturer’s recommended pressure (found on the driver’s door jamb).
  • Inspect tires for uneven wear and replace if necessary.
6. Test and Replace Oxygen Sensors (if needed)
  • Locate the upstream and downstream oxygen sensors.
  • Test the sensors with a multimeter for voltage output.
  • If out of specification, remove and replace the faulty sensor with a new one.
